Course objective | It is aimed to identify the methods based on current applied behavior analysis approach, methods based on natural behavioral development intervention approaches, technology based practices and new research trends in the teaching of skills to individuals with OSD and to discuss research findings and advanced research proposals within the scope of advanced researches | |||||

Course Content | Educational approaches in individuals with ASD Current research trends in individuals with ASD Current natural behavioral intervention approach in individuals with ASD Research on current applied behavior analysis approach in individuals with ASD Current technology-based applied research in individuals with ASD Intervention approach research based on metacognitive strategies in teaching academic skills in individuals with ASD Discussion of current intervention approach research findings in individuals with ASD Determination of advanced research proposals in individuals with ASD within the framework of current intervention approaches. | |||||
References | Schreibman, L., Dawson, G., Stahmer, A. C., Landa, R., Rogers, S. J., McGee, G. G., ... & McNerney, E. (2015). Naturalistic developmental behavioral interventions: Empirically validated treatments for autism spectrum disorder. Journal of autism and developmental disorders, 45(8), 2411-2428. Makrygianni, M. K., Gena, A., Katoudi, S., & Galanis, P. (2018). The effectiveness of applied behavior analytic interventions for children with Autism Spectrum Disorder: A meta-analytic study. Research in Autism Spectrum Disorders, 51, 18-31. Lee, C. S., Lam, S. H., Tsang, S. T., Yuen, C. M., & Ng, C. K. (2018). The Effectiveness of Technology-Based Intervention in Improving Emotion Recognition Through Facial Expression in People with Autism Spectrum Disorder: a Systematic Review. Review Journal of Autism and Developmental Disorders, 5(2), 91-104. |
